launch: refactor to work
This was never consistently showing the host key and sshfp records
upon launch.

Upon digging, a number of things are going wrong.

The socket.create_connection() check isn't waiting for the host to be
up properly.  This means the keyscans were not working, and we'd get
blank return values [1].  We have a ssh_connect() routine, rework it
to use that to probe.  We add a close method to the sshclient so we
can shut it down too.

I don't know why the inventory output was in dns.py, as it's not
really DNS.  Move it to the main launch_node.py, and simplify it by
using f-strings.  While we're here, deliminate the output a bit more
and make white-space more consistent.

This allows us to simplify dns.py and make it so it handles multiple
domains.

Since we're actually waiting for ssh to be up now, the keyscan works
better and this outputs the information we want.  A sample of this is

  https://paste.opendev.org/show/b1MjiTvYr4E03GTeP56w/

[1] ssh-keyscan has a very short timeout, and just returns blank if it
    doesn't get a response to it's probes.  We weren't checking its
    return code.
